ConductAtlas Analysis

Why it matters (compliance & governance perspective)

The clause establishes a unilateral modification mechanism for pricing terms, allowing the service provider to adjust fees without individual user consent beyond the acceptance-through-continued-use framework. This structure allocates pricing flexibility to the operator while requiring statutory notice procedures.

This document changed recently

Medium May 15, 2026

The updated terms now authorize Wise to accept incoming funds via FedNow, a new instant payment service. The agreement states that FedNow transactions are processed in real time and generally cannot be canceled or reversed once completed, distinguishing them from traditional transfers that may have reversal windows. The terms also establish that Wise may decline any incoming FedNow transaction at its discretion where required for security, compliance, or operational reasons, without specifying advance notice or appeal procedures. Users receiving FedNow payments should understand that such transfers become final immediately upon completion.

Consumer impact (what this means for users)

Users operate under a fee structure that varies by transaction parameters and may change at Wise's discretion, with new fees taking effect upon notice and user continuation of service. The terms do not require affirmative consent to fee modifications beyond continued use after notice.

▸ View Original Clause Language DOCUMENT RECORD
"
We charge fees for our services, which are displayed at the time of your transaction and are also available on our pricing page. Fees may vary depending on the currency, amount, payment method, and destination. We reserve the right to change our fees at any time. We will provide notice of fee changes in accordance with applicable law. Your continued use of the services after a fee change becomes effective constitutes your acceptance of the new fees.

— Excerpt from Wise's Wise Terms of Use
